A 29-year-old man was arrested for a knife attack in Stoneybatter, Dublin, during which three people, ranging from their mid-20s to mid-40s, were seriously injured. The suspect, armed with a Stanley blade and scissors, reportedly had links to the drugs trade and was homeless at the time of his arrest. Although the attack was described as "random," authorities have not yet established a clear motive, sparking concerns over public safety within the community.
